数据库的概念模型 数据库的概念模型和逻辑模型都需要对应DBMS的支持
编程之家今天给各位分享数据库的概念模型的知识,其中也会对数据库的概念模型和逻辑模型都需要对应DBMS的支持进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!
数据库主要有哪些模型?这些模型的特点是什么?
1、目前最常用的三种数据模型为层次模型、网状模型和关系模型。层次模型 层次模型将数据组织成一对多关系的结构,层次结构采用关键字来访问其中每一层次的每一部分。层次模型发展最早,它以树结构为基本结构,典型代表是IMS模型。
2、数据库主要的模型有:层次结构模型、网状结构模型、关系结构模型。层次结构模型 定义 有且仅有一个节点,无父节点,此节点为树的根;其他节点有且仅有一个父节点。
3、概念数据模型 特点是面向用户、面向现实世界的数据模型,描述一个单位的概念化结构;具有较强的语义表达能力,能够方便、直接地表达应用中的各种语义知识;简单、清晰、易于用户理解;概念模型是充满主观色彩的工件。
数据库主要有哪几种数据模型?
1、当前常见的三种数据库数据模型是:层次模型、网状模型、关系模型。相关知识点介绍 数据库模型描述了在数据库中结构化和操纵数据的方法,模型的结构部分规定了数据如何被描述(例如树、表等)。
2、数据模型所描述的内容有三部分:数据结构、数据操作和数据约束。数据库技术发展至今,主要有三种数据模型:层次数据模型、网状数据模型、关系数据模型。层次模型发展最早,它以树结构为基本结构,典型代表是IMS模型。
3、数据模型的分类:最常用的数据模型是概念数据模型和结构数据模型。概念数据模型:面向用户的,按照用户的观点进行建模。结构数据模型:面向计算机系统的,用于DBMS的实现。
4、数据库模型由以下三部分组成,分别是数据操作、数据结构和数据约束。按照不同的应用层次,数据模型可以分为以下三类,分别为逻辑数据模型、概念数据模型与物理数据模型。
5、传统的基本数据模型有以下三种:层次模型 层次模型是一种树结构模型,它把数据按自然的层次关系组织起来,以反映数据之间的隶属关系。层次模型是数据库技术中发展最早、技术上比较成熟的一种数据模型。
6、按数据的组织形式分,数据模型可分为层次模型、网状模型和关系模型。层次模型用树形结构描述实体间的关系;网状模型用图结构描述实体间的关系;关系模型用二维表描述实体间的关系。
数据库设计的概念模型描述的是
概念模型是数据库设计的第一步,用于描述系统中的实体、属性、关系和约束条件。概念模型是一个抽象的、独立于任何具体实现技术的模型,可以帮助数据库设计者更好地理解系统的需求和设计方案,并为后续的物理模型设计提供基础。
数据库的概念模型是面向对象数据库系统是为了满足新的数据库应用需要而产生的新一代数据库系统。面向对象是一种认识方法学,也是一种新的程序设计方法学。数据库概念模型实际上是现实世界到机器世界的一个中间层次。
概念数据模型是面向用户、面向现实世界的数据模型,是与DBMS无关的。它主要用来描述一个单位的概念化结构。
概念模型描述了数据库中的数据实体、它们之间的关系以及数据的约束条件,但不涉及数据如何存储、管理或访问。这使得数据库设计人员可以独立于具体的DBMS或硬件平台,设计出符合业务需求和数据完整性的概念模型。